Verifying LED Panel Function

Functional testing of LED panels involves a meticulous evaluation of their operation. A common method utilized in this process is grid pattern analysis. This technique entails illuminating the panel with specific patterns, allowing for thorough inspection of each individual pixel. Any aberrations detected within the grid pattern, such as faulty LEDs, promptly signal a potential problem. Through this systematic methodology, manufacturers can pinpoint defective units and ensure the integrity of their LED panel production.

Automated LED Screen Quality Control with Grid Testing

In the realm of visual technology, ensuring the perfection of LED screens is paramount. Producers now leverage advanced grid testing techniques to automate the quality control process. This method involves implementing a grid pattern over the screen surface and analyzing each pixel's intensity. Any discrepancy from the standard values triggers an alert, prompting immediate rectification. Grid testing offers impeccable accuracy, accelerating the process and minimizing the risk of defective screens reaching consumers.
